SQL Server操作:怎样删除表
要删除在SQL Server数据库中的表,可使用Transact-SQL命令DROP TABLE。 如果需要,一定要同时将表中的全部数据删除,然后再删除表。 如果要删除的表具有外键束缚,则可能一定要先删除相关表中的外键束缚,然后再删除表本身。
以下是在SQL Server中删除表的步骤:
1、在SQL Server Management Studio中连接到数据库服务器。
2、右键单击数据库中要删除表的名称,然后选择“删除表”,以开始删除进程。
3、一旦进入删除对话框,可以看到需要删除表所一定要的所有信息,可使用“查看查询”按钮,查看DROP TABLE语句的T-SQL语句和参数的含义,确认会不会需要修改DROP TABLE语句的参数,确保能够删除正确的表。
4、如果表中存在外键,查询设计器会提示解决此问题,以便回收被束缚的表中的资源。 在接受删除外键束缚提示后,应首先删除表中的外键,然后再删除表本身。
5、要删除表中的数据,可使用DELETE语句。 使用DELETE语句可以从表中删除行。 如此,要删除的表中的全部行都将删除,然后可使用DROP TABLE语句删除此表。
例如:
// Delete table
DROP TABLE table_name;
// Delete from table
DELETE FROM table_name;
6、最后,也能够使用DROP TABLE IF EXISTS语句删除表。 使用此语句可以肯定要删除的表会不会存在。 如果表存在,它将被删除,如果表不存在,则不会产生任何操作。
总结
使用DROP TABLE命令可以删除SQL Server数据库中的表,在删除表之前,可使用DELETE语句删除表中的所有行,然后再删除表。 如果要删除的表具有外键束缚,则可能一定要先删除相关表中的外键束缚,在实际利用中也能够使用DROP TABLE IF EXISTS语句来肯定要删除的表会不会存在。
本文来源:https://www.yuntue.com/post/181974.html | 云服务器网,转载请注明出处!

微信扫一扫打赏
支付宝扫一扫打赏